Shelf Under Dash, Removal?????????
When I bought the car, the salesman said the little shelf under the dash could be used for the owner's manual. Unfortunately, the whole folder will not fit. Want it outta there. Looked at the two mounting fasteners with a mirror and first thought was that they are allen head screws. But could get nothing to engage them. What is the secret to removing the little shelf that does nothing but encroach on legroom?
Gramps,
From posts on funcarsonline, I think they are rivets that must be drilled out. Eric 'The plug guy' at bumperplugs.com was trying to develop plugs for the holes that remain. Don't know if he has yet. Good luck. Agree that it's a useless little shelf if it's any consolation!

They are infact rivets, though - like most other items in this incredibly engineered machine, they just pop out. It takes a little force, but it does come out. No drilling or screwing necessary.
